Re: [users] Formulas

2005-07-21 Thread Paul
Under tools > options > calc > view have a look at the options under "display" ... Check the box that says 'formulas'. This will display the formula of the cell instead of the result. It is then easy to print out the sheet... /paul On 7/21/05, Robert Tarnowski <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> How in
